"Paul is Dead" clues from Sgt. Pepper's Lonely Hearts Club Band



In 1969, a widespread rumor that Beatles bassist Paul McCartney had died and been replaced in late 1966 developed. These rumors were based on "clues" found on album covers, in lyrics, and by playing lyrics backwards.
